I never leave a review, but after stopping by for a cortado this morning I feel so inclined to leave one. This coffee shop might be my new favorite in Portland. The coffee was amazingly pulled and poured, they have a nice selection of different beans you can get brewed and they roast in house. The prices were very fair and they were hosting a local bakery on the sidewalk right outside serving delicious pastries and fresh baked bread. The atmosphere was immaculate even though it was busy with almost every seat taken. Had to leave with a second cortado and a loaf of bread. Will definitely be coming back and bringing friends.
